On 6/26/2004 5:19 AM, Hector Santos wrote:

So the customer was right about his ISP saying it was illegal to use
_EP.hostname.com for a TXT record?

A domain name contains a series of labels.

Any label may contain character codes 0x00 through 0xFF.

A hostname may only contain labels with a-z, A-Z, 0-9, and "-" (there are
length and ordering restrictions too).

A TXT RR can be associated with any domain name and is not limited to
hostnames. The ISP is wrong.
